Coronavirus: Drake ‘in self-isolation’ after partying with infected NBA player Kevin Durant
Drake has reportedly been forced to self-isolate after partying with NBA player Kevin Durant, who recently tested positive for coronavirus.
According to Page Six, Drake is now holed up in his mansion after hanging out with Durant just days before the Brooklyn Nets basketball player was diagnosed.
The "Hotline Bling" singer had posted a photo of himself with Durant at the West Hollywood venue Nice Guy.
Durant was visiting LA because the Nets were playing against the Lakers, although Durant himself was ruled out with an injury before testing positive with the virus.
While there is no suggestion that Drake has been diagnosed with the virus himself, several other high-profile celebrities have come down with the infectious disease.
Tom Hanks was the first big Hollywood star to catch coronavirus, with Idris Elba and Quantum of Solace actor Olga Kurylenko among those following suit.
